Biblical Meaning of Hot Water in a Dream

When you dream of hot water, you might be experiencing a wake-up call from your subconscious. In biblical terms, hot water symbolizes spiritual purification and cleansing, urging you to confront and overcome inner struggles. It's as if God's refining fire is burning away impurities, revealing a renewed and revitalized self. But what exactly is your dream trying to tell you? Is it a call to repentance, a warning sign of emotional turmoil, or a promise of spiritual renewal? As you reflect on your dream, you'll begin to uncover the hidden meaning behind the hot water, and what it reveals about your soul.

In a Nutshell

  • In the Bible, hot water symbolizes purification, judgment, and spiritual cleansing, as seen in Psalm 66:10-12 and Isaiah 1:25.
  • Hot water in a dream can represent God's refining fire, purifying the soul and burning away impurities, as mentioned in Malachi 3:2-3.
  • The Bible associates hot water with emotional turmoil, as seen in Luke 12:49-50, where Jesus speaks of fire that divides and brings judgment.
  • In a dream, hot water can signify a call to repentance, urging the dreamer to turn away from sin and towards God's righteousness, as in 2 Peter 3:10-13.
  • The biblical meaning of hot water in a dream can also represent spiritual awakening, renewal, and transformation, as seen in Ezekiel 36:25-27.

Uncovering the Symbolism of Water

As you plumb into the domain of dream analysis, have you ever stopped to ponder the profound significance of water, an element that has been imbued with symbolic meaning across cultures and centuries?

Water's versatility and omnipresence have led to its association with various aspects of human life, from sustenance and purification to spiritual renewal and transformation.

In dreams, water often represents the subconscious, emotions, and the collective unconscious.

The source of water in your dream can hold significant meaning, with flowing water symbolizing change, renewal, and emotional release, while stagnant water may indicate emotional blockages or unresolved issues.

Delving into the spiritual depths of water's symbolism, you may discover that it's connected to your inner world, intuition, and emotional intelligence.

Exploring the symbolism of water can help you tap into your subconscious, gaining a deeper understanding of yourself and the world around you.
